I am using asp.net mvc3. I want to pass an array from view to the controller using parameterMap as shown below. In my view:
parameterMap:
function (data, options) {
if (options === "read") {
sessionStorage.setItem("value","array");
val = sessionStorage.getItem("value"); // contains array
return { model: JSON.stringify(val) }; //passing array to controller
}
}
In controller:
public ActionResult SearchDetails( string model)
{
var query = (from ......).where();//want to compare array values in controller
}
but I am not able to retrieve those values in the controller. How can I retrieve these array of values in my controller without using looping statements?
My array contains only integer values (ids), while debugging the when I put cursor at the parameter of action method the values are coming in ""[{\"id\":1},{\"id\":2}]"" format. How can I use this array of values in my WHERE clause of my query?
